librelad cd4fd55a6d feat(desudo): helper-ize backup-engine + app-config installs; retire standalone WireGuard
Bring the remaining deferred subsystems under the scoped sudoers, and drop
the one that's redundant.

Backup engines + app configs -> root-owned helpers (same pattern as
ownership/dns/ssh/socket/svc):
- scripts/system/libreportal-bininstall: install <restic|kopia> — does the
  whole pkg-manager/signed-download install itself for a fixed, validated
  engine name (no blanket sudo apt-get/install). restic_install/kopia_install
  call it.
- scripts/system/libreportal-appcfg: {adguard-auth <user> <bcrypt>|
  crowdsec-priority|owncloud-config <public> <host> <ip> <public_ip>} —
  faithful ports of the AdGuard yaml / CrowdSec bouncer / ownCloud config.php
  rewrites, fixed paths + validated args. adguard_auth/crowdsec_fix_priority/
  owncloud_setup_config call it.
- run_privileged: runBinInstall / runAppCfg; init.sh installs + allowlists both.

Retire standalone (host-level) WireGuard — it's a duplicate of the
containerized containers/wireguard app (+ headscale mesh), its slirp4netns
speed rationale is largely moot with a better rootless net backend / typical
WAN-bound throughput, and it was the heaviest host-root subsystem (apt +
sysctl + iptables + /etc/wireguard), the worst fit for the rootless/
least-privilege direction:
- moved scripts/wireguard/ + manage_wireguard.sh + check_wireguard.sh to
  scripts/unused/; dropped the install-path call, the Tools menu 'w' entry,
  and the requirement check; removed the half-built libreportal-wg helper.
- generate_arrays.sh now also skips system/ (root-owned helpers, never
  sourced); arrays regenerated (files_wireguard.sh pruned).

#!/bin/bash
appCrowdSecFixPriority() {
local cfg="/etc/crowdsec/bouncers/crowdsec-firewall-bouncer.yaml"
if [[ ! -f "$cfg" ]]; then
isNotice "Bouncer config not found at $cfg — is CrowdSec installed?"
return 1
fi
# The bouncer yaml is root-owned under /etc/crowdsec; the backup + nftables
# ipv4/ipv6 priority rewrite (to -100) runs in the root-owned appcfg helper.
runAppCfg crowdsec-priority
checkSuccess "Patched nftables priority to -100 in $cfg"
runSystem systemctl restart crowdsec-firewall-bouncer
checkSuccess "Restarted crowdsec-firewall-bouncer"
isSuccessful "Priority updated. Run 'crowdsec_verify_firewall' to confirm CrowdSec now runs before UFW."
}
